Transcribed Image Text:Define f : [0,4] → R by f(x) = x² + 1. For each of the following partitions of [0, 4], find L(P, f) and U(P, f).
(a) P = {0,1, 2, 4}
%3D
(b) P = {0,1,2, 3, 4}
